Synopsis by Cammila Collar

Sick and tired of his family's refusal to acknowledge his multi-racial background, filmmaker Octavio Warnock-Graham confronts his mother and extended family with a camera, creating a 25 minute documentary about the strange silence that the white side of his family exhibits when asked about the circumstances of his birth, and the larger reflections of Midwestern culture that it represents.
